1.高可靠概念 HA(High Available):高可用性集群,是保证业务连续性的有效解决方案,一般有两个或两个以上的节点,且分为活动节点及备用节点2.Hadoop的HA运作机制: :正式引入HA机制是从hadoop2.0开始,之前的版本中没有HA机制,:所谓HA,即高可用(7*24小时不中断服务),实现高可用最关键的是消除单点故障 :Hadoop-HA严格来说应该分成各个组件的HA机制
转载
2023-08-20 22:54:41
345阅读
Hadoop高可用搭建一、集群规划四台主机,主机映射如下图[root@mast conf]# cat /etc/hosts
127.0.0.1 localhost localhost.localdomain localhost4 localhost4.localdomain4
::1 localhost localhost.localdomain localhost6 loca
转载
2024-01-03 15:45:29
48阅读
1、冗余副本策略可以在 hdfs-site.xml 中设置复制因子指定副本数量。所有数据块都可副本。DataNode 启动时,遍历本地文件系统,产生一份 HDFS 数据块和本地文件的对应关系列表(BlockReport)汇报给 NameNode。2、机架策略HDFS 的“机架感知”,通过节点之间发送一个数据包,来感应它们是否在同一个机架。一般在本机架放一个副本,在其他机架再存放一个副本,这样可以防
转载
2023-11-24 22:38:40
70阅读
三种HA的机制,有关于优先级,权重,抢占是否打开,是否支持追踪,VRRP使用真实IP地址的意义。 时间机制
原创
2011-06-09 20:46:34
927阅读
简单hdfs高可用架构图 在hadoop2.x中通常由两个NameNode组成,一个处于active状态,另一个处于standby状态。Active NameNode对外提供服务,而Standby NameNode则不对外提供服务,仅同步active namenode的状态,以便能够在它失败时快速进行切换。 &n
转载
2017-05-05 16:17:58
839阅读
概述 简单hdfs高可用架构图 在hadoop2.x中通常由两个NameNode组成,一个处于active状态,另一个处于standby状态。Active NameNode对外提供服务,而Standby NameNode则不对外提供服务,仅同步active namenode的状态,以便能够在它失败时快速进行切换。 hadoop2.x官方提
原创
2017-05-15 14:40:42
598阅读
高可靠性
HA高可靠性,特征实现系统的高可靠性,支持HA特性的设备有两块单板,一块为主用板,工作在Master模式,另一块为备用板工作在Slave模式,用户不能直接对备用板进行命令操作,需要通过主用板的命令行界面进行配置,然后主用板会将配置同步给备用板,来保持主备板当前配置一致HA主要体现两个方面1、当主用板故障或拔出时,备用板将迅速自动取代主用板称为新的主用板,保证设备的继续运行2
转载
2023-11-07 02:49:20
83阅读
目录一、高可靠性背景二、HA High Availability 高可靠性概述三、可靠性四、高可靠性在园区的应用五、链路备份技术六、链路聚合七、RRPP八、Smart Link九、设备备份技术十、设备自身的备份技术十一、设备间备份技术VRRP十二、堆叠十三、三大集群技术 一、高可靠性背景在当前的组网应用中 用户对网络可靠性的要求越来越高 特别是在一些重要的业务入口或接入点上需要保证网络不间断运行
转载
2023-11-14 11:02:08
136阅读
1.原理1.1 什么是高可用集群高可用集群就是当某一个节点或服务器发生故障时,另一个节点能够自动且立即向外提供服务,即将有故障节点上的资源转移到另一个节点上去,这样另一个节点有了资源既可以向外提供服务。高可用集群是用于单个节点发生故障时,能够自动将资源、服务进行切换,这样可以保证服务一直在线。在这个过程中,对于客户端来说是透明的。1.2 高可用集群的衡量标准高可用集群一般是通过系统的可靠性(rel
转载
2023-10-08 08:33:06
318阅读
HDFS的高可靠性的策略机制有哪些?分布式文件系统(HDFS)的高可靠性主要是由多种策略及机制共同作用实现的。常见的三种错误情况:文件损坏、网络或者机器失效、NameNode挂掉。
下面我们来看下解决三种常见错误的可靠性策略:1.文件完整性–CRC32校验,验证数据是否损坏
在文件建立时,每个数据块都产生校验和,校验和会保存在.meta文件内;
客户端获取数据时可以检查校验和是否相同,从而发现
转载
2024-03-25 16:32:29
185阅读
# 实现mysql高可靠性配置
## 概述
在实际的生产环境中,mysql数据库的高可用性是非常重要的。为了保证数据的安全和稳定性,我们需要配置mysql的高可靠性。本文将通过一系列步骤和代码示例来教会刚入行的小白如何实现mysql的高可靠性配置。
## 配置步骤
下表展示了实现mysql高可靠性配置的步骤:
| 步骤 | 描述 |
| --- | --- |
| 1 | 安装并配置主从复制
原创
2024-03-10 04:21:38
62阅读
拓补图如下:
1. 浮动静态路由
配置一条主链路,一条辅助链路!正常情况使用主链路,主链路出现故障,切换到辅助链路!
H3C
主线路 s0-s0 采用ospf 默认度量值是10,辅助线路 s1-s1 配置静态路由,默认度量值是10,无需调整,数据包默认值走s0-s0链路
CISCO
主线路 s0-s0 采用ospf 默认度量值是1
原创
2011-10-13 18:09:03
952阅读
点赞
2评论
高可靠性架构论文探讨
在当今高度依赖技术的环境中,高可靠性架构(High Availability Architecture)显得尤为重要。随着企业对服务持续性和系统可用性的要求不断提升,研究和构建高可靠性的系统架构变得至关重要。本文将围绕高可靠性架构的背景、技术原理和架构解析进行深入探讨,并提供源码分析、性能优化及其应用场景的详细描述。
### 背景描述
高可靠性架构是指通过设计和实现冗余
在当今快速发展的信息技术领域,高可靠性架构的设计越来越受到重视。随着数据中心和云计算的普及,确保应用程序和系统的高可用性、可扩展性及稳定性成为每个IT架构师需要面对的重要课题。为了全面探讨如何设计一个高可靠性的架构,本篇博文将详细介绍相关背景、技术原理、架构解析、源码分析、性能优化和未来展望等内容。
```mermaid
timeline
title 高可靠性架构发展时间轴
20
软件可靠性 (software reliability )——软件可靠性是软件产品在规定的条件下和规定的时间区间完成规定功能的能力。规定的条件是指直接与软件运行相关的使用该软件的计算机系统的状态和软件的输入条件,或统称为软件运行时的外部输入条件;规定的时间区间是指软件的实际运行时间区间;规定功能是指为提供给定的服务,软件产品所必须具备的功能。软件可靠性不但与软件存在的缺陷和(或)差错有关,而且与系
转载
2023-09-20 21:23:30
218阅读
文章目录Hadoop HA高可用安装主机基础环境配置安装JAVA环境安装zookeeper安装Hadoop开始修改配置开始启动页面访问测试可能存在的其他疑惑1. edits日志数量特别多2. 高可用状态下主备切换有问题3. 阿里云的emr集群配置 Hadoop HA高可用安装此方案注意问题hdfs-site.xml文件中的dfs.ha.fencing.methods参数为shell而非sshfe
转载
2024-06-19 10:09:38
32阅读
高可靠性-HSRP&VRRP
HRSP协议
HSRP:热备份路由器协议(HSRP:Hot Standby Router Protocol),是cisco平台一种特有的技术,是cisco的私有协议。
一、HSRP协议概述
实现HSRP的条件是系统中有多台路由器,它们组成一个“热备份组”,这个组形成一个虚拟路由器。在任一时刻,一个组内只有一个路由
原创
2012-03-15 00:09:58
1110阅读
1、背景介绍 Hadoop2.0.0之前,在一个HDFS集群中,NameNode存在单节点故障(SPOF):因为集群中只有一个NameNode
原创
2024-08-15 13:51:29
50阅读
随着大数据技术的发展,数据挖掘、数据探索等专有名词的曝光度越来越高,但是在类似于Hadoop系列的大数据分析系统大行其道之前,数据分析工作已经历了长足的发展,尤其是以BI系统为主的数据分析,已经有了非常成熟和稳定的技术方案和生态系统,对于BI系统来说,大概的架构图如下: 可以看到在BI系统里面,核心的模块是Cube。Cube是一个更高层的业务模型抽象,在Cube之上可以进行多种操作,例如
转载
2024-09-29 21:52:34
21阅读
什么是高可用性? 高可用集群是指以减少服务中断时间为目的的服务器集群技术。 高可用性HA(HighAvailability)指的是通过尽量缩短因日常维护操作(计划)和突发的系统崩溃(非计划)所导致的停机时间,以提高系统和应用的可用性。&n
转载
2023-12-05 21:30:00
25阅读